* STEAM is an educational approach that incorporates the arts into the more-familiar STEM model, which includes science, technology, engineering, and mathematics. After brief introductions are made, the teacher will introduce the topic with an interactive Google Slides presentation about the blue-ringed octopus. Students will have a chance to answer questions and make comments as they see a map of the animal's range and learn about its predators and prey, camouflage, size, venom, and...
This class is taught in English.
Students will use listening skills to follow step-by-step directions on how to draw a blue-ringed octopus. Students will learn interesting facts about this beautiful, venomous creature. Students will have the option to be creative when they finish their octopus drawing by adding extra ocean creatures, seaweed, and water to their art piece. ***If your student needs accommodations please let me know and we will work together to ensure that they have the best possible class experience.***
